Course Content

• Global Epidemiology of Lyme Disease and Antibiotic Resistance
• Pathogenesis of Borrelia burgdorferi and its implications for treatment
• Current Antibiotic Treatment Strategies for Lyme Disease
• Diagnostic Challenges in Lyme Disease and their impact on treatment choices
• Emerging Antibiotic Resistance in Lyme Disease: Mechanisms and surveillance
• Development of Novel Therapeutics for Lyme Disease
• Public Health Strategies for Combating Lyme Disease
• Vector Control and Prevention Strategies for Lyme Disease
• Ethical Considerations in Lyme Disease Management and Research
• Post-Treatment Lyme Disease Syndrome (PTLDS): Diagnosis and Management

Career path

Career Role (Global Antibiotic Strategies & Lyme Disease - UK) Description
Infectious Disease Specialist (Lyme & Antibiotic Resistance) Diagnoses and treats Lyme disease, focusing on antibiotic stewardship and resistance strategies. High demand due to increasing Lyme cases and antibiotic resistance concerns.
Microbiologist (Antimicrobial Resistance) Studies microbial resistance mechanisms in Lyme disease bacteria. Crucial role in informing antibiotic strategies and developing new treatments.
Public Health Officer (Lyme Disease Prevention & Control) Develops and implements public health strategies to prevent and control Lyme disease spread, encompassing antibiotic usage guidelines.
Pharmaceutical Research Scientist (Lyme Disease Therapeutics) Conducts research to develop new antibiotics and alternative therapies for Lyme disease, addressing the challenges of antibiotic resistance.
